KARAPATAN to ICC Pre-Trial Chamber I: Confirm murder, attempted murder charges vs Duterte
KARAPATAN human rights alliance urges the Pre-Trial Chamber I of the International Criminal Court (ICC) to confirm the charges of murder and attempted murder against Rodrigo Duterte so that the proceedings could soon move on to the trial stage.
Duterte’s defense team has been filing motion after motion, all designed to delay and derail the confirmation of charges and the trial itself. These motions betray the Duterte camp’s fears that their client’s acts are indefensible, and their best bet hinges on such dilatory tactics and harping on unfounded claims that Duterte is unfit to stand trial.
The ICC Pre-Trial Chamber I has already denied the Duterte camp’s motions to disqualify three of the victims’ lawyers and to disclose more personal information on a number of prosecution witnesses, including their whereabouts -- a move that could have endangered their lives, safety and security.
After hurdling these obstacles, the ICC Pre-Trial Chamber is set to conduct confirmation of charges hearings which will span four days (February 23-24, 26-27) and help it determine whether the prosecution has sufficient evidence to establish substantial grounds to proceed to trial.
